Religious/Sacred Music is the 613th most popular major in the country with 481 degrees awarded in 2019-2020.

Across Nebraska, there were 1 religious/sacred music graduates with average earnings and debt of $0 and $0 respectively. At the bachelor’s degree level specifically, there were 1 religious/sacred music graduates with average earnings and debt of $40,068 and $24,613 respectively.

Out of the 1 schools in the Best Value Religious Music Schools for a Bachelor’s in Nebraska For Those Making $48-$75k that were part of this year’s ranking, Concordia University, Nebraska landed the #1 spot on the list. Located in Seward, Nebraska, this small private not-for-profit school awarded 1 degrees to qualified bachelors’s religious music students in 2019-2020.

Concordia University, Nebraska also took the #1 spot in our “Best Religious/Sacred Music Bachelor’s Degree Schools in Nebraska” ranking. The yearly cost to attend Concordia University, Nebraska is $19,567 for Nebraska Bachelor’s Degree Religious Music students whose families make $48-$75k.
